Dear
Pat,
I just read your on-line article, "Most Asked Questions on
Dating." My daughter recently met a young man that said,
"I have dated more girls than I can remember." However,
he seems polite, educated, and religious. I feel very strongly
that my daughter should only date men that are pure. How and when
should she ask this young man if he is pure? They have only known
each other for 2 weeks.
Thank you.
Dear
Concerned Mother,
Let me offer three words of advice. First, the Holy Spirit leads
us into all truth (John 16). If you do not have the peace of God,
if there are signs of concern, seriously pray about it and if
you really are seeking after God's will, He will lead you to the
right path. Second, I would warn against getting involved with
a person who says he has "dated more girls than he can remember."
From this comment I would conclude he does not seriously care
for the other girls he got involved with. He was not concerned
about their feelings, nor the hurt the break up caused. He obviously
is not committed and is quite self-centered seeking to satisfy
his interests and then move on when the other person no longer
is of interest to him. Finally, on the issue of purity, if it
is of concern, it should be asked. God commands that we be pure
and holy. This is an important question and if he is truly seeking
to obey the Lord, this young man should not be afraid to answer
truthfully this question.
